Specifications include, but are not limited to: The goal of this RFP is to secure a consultant to design, assist in permitting, coordinate with utility providers, and provide construction administration and inspection services for a new Backup Generation system CWRF. The system shall be reliable and provide ease of operations for MWS staff. CWRF currently has dual feeds from Nashville Electric Service (NES) to supply electricity to the Central campus, which is comprised of CWRF, Central Biosolids, and MWS Administration building. Currently, the average electrical use is approximately 9MW with a peak of approximately 12MW. CWRF is on a Large General Power Rate Schedule with NES. The selected design consultant shall provide a design that will connect into the existing hot house where existing dual NES feeds enter the facility. An automatic transfer switch and phase synchronization shall be integrated into the overall design. generators and supporting electrical components will also be included in the design. Selected firm will review current electrical plant loading and future anticipated loads for appropriate selection of generators. The generators shall be capable of providing standby power to the site as well as providing peak shaving capabilities by controlling generation output but avoiding exporting power from the site. The design is to include relaying specifications and settings, protective device coordination, and Arc-flash studies for the completed project. Grounding plans are to be incorporated during the design effort. Selected firm will provide plans and facilitate coordination with integration of the new generation system with the existing ABB 800xA system. Detailed design work will include civil, mechanical, geotechnical, electrical, instrumentation and control engineering services. Selected vendor will also be responsible for construction administration and inspection services during the construction phase of the project. Consultant will provide all surveying and engineering services required to complete the project as outlined in the solicitation. Deliverables are to consist of preliminary design report, plan drawings and specifications. An architect and/or engineer licensed to practice in the State of Tennessee must seal the respective drawings and specifications. An initial feasibility study conducted by ABB is included with this solicitation that outlines anticipated generator bank location, size, and general information about the existing utilities. Information contained in the report should be considered preliminary and any assumption or conclusions derived may change or reevaluated during the design process.
